Quality Analysis 80/100
This half-zip jacket, crafted from crinkled nylon-ripstop, offers good tear resistance, making it a reliable choice for everyday wear. The mid-weight fabric further enhances its resilience, ensuring it holds up well over time.
Comfort Assessment 60/100
This half-zip jacket, with its relaxed fit and baggy cut, offers a comfortable, unrestrictive feel, perfect for layering over cotton-jersey sweats. However, the mid-weight, non-stretchy fabric might limit some movement.
Sustainability Impact 60/100
This jacket is made from 100% nylon ripstop with a 100% polyester lining, both conventional fossil-fuel synthetics without any mention of recycled content, which impacts its sustainability score.
